Description

【0001】
【発明の属する技術分野】
この発明は、殺し処理したマグロ等の大形魚に関するものである。
【0002】
【従来の技術】
マグロ等の大形魚を捕獲した場合に、魚体の鮮度を保つためには、迅速かつ確実に殺し処理する必要がある。このような殺し処理に適した処理方法として、魚体の頭部の白紋部分又は頭部の切断面から線状の殺し処理具を差し込み、これを脊柱内部に達せしめ、中枢神経組織を破壊する方法が従来から知られている。また、上記の殺し処理具を殺し処理後の魚体内に残置せしめ、市場においてその処理具を確認することにより、その魚体が上記の方法により処理されたものであることを需要者、取引者に知らせるようにすることも知られている(実公平2−3757号公報、実公平4−36624号公報、実公平4−55516号公報参照)。
【0003】
【発明が解決しようとする課題】
上記の殺し処理したマグロ等の大形魚は、処理具を尾部近くまで差し込むことことにより適正な処理が行われたことになるが、従来は魚体の頭部から処理具の一端を露出させていただけであったので、その他端が尾部近くまで達しているかどうかを市場において確認することが困難であった。
【0004】
そこで、この発明は上記の処理具が確実に尾部近くまで差し込まれ、適正に処理されていることが市場において容易に確認できるようにすることを課題とする。
【0005】
【課題を解決するための手段】
上記の課題を解決するため、この発明は、魚体の頭部から脊柱内部に線状の殺し処理具を差し込み、上記処理具を脊柱内部に残置せしめてなる殺し処理した大形魚において、上記殺し処理具の一端を魚体の尾部から外部に露出させ、上記の一端に連続した該処理具の他端を該魚体の頭部から外部に露出させるようにしたものである。
【0006】
上記の殺し処理具の一端を上記魚体の尾部の切断面から外部に露出させること、またその一端を上記魚体の尾部の上記脊柱に達する切欠き部から外部に露出させることができる。
【0007】
また、上記の殺し処理具の他端を上記魚体の頭部の白紋部分から外部に露出させること、また、その他端を上記魚体の頭部の切断面から外部に露出させることができる。
【0008】
【発明の実施の形態】
以下、この発明の実施形態を図面を参照して説明する。図1に示した第1実施形態において使用される殺し処理具1は、線状の合成樹脂(ナイロン、ポリプロピレン等)を大形魚の魚体2に応じた所定長さに切断したものである。その太さは3〜5mm程度である。中空のチューブ状のものでもよいが、その場合は両端に閉塞栓を嵌着する。
【0009】
マグロ等の大形魚の魚体2の両眼の中間部分には比較的柔軟な白紋部がある。捕獲した大形魚の魚体2の上記の白紋部を刃物で刺すか、削ぐかして頭蓋骨3の一部に穴4をあけ、また尾部5を切り落とす。尾部5を切り落とした後の切断面には脊柱6の切断端が現れる。
【0010】
次に、上記の穴4に殺し処理具1の一端を差し込み、これを押し進めて頭蓋骨3の内部から脊柱6の中を通して尾部5側の切断端から外部に露出させる。殺し処理具1の差し込みにより、魚体2の脳、脊髄等の中枢神経組織が破壊され、魚体2を迅速に完全死に至らしめることができる。
【0011】
殺し処理を完了した後、殺し処理具1の一方の端部1aを尾部5の切断面から外部に所要長さ露出させ、また、この端部1aに連続した他方の端部1bを頭部8側の穴4から外部に所要長さ露出させ、両端部1a,1bを露出させたまま市場に出荷する。市場においては、殺し処理具1の両端部1a,1bを確認することにより、頭部8から脊柱6の全長にわたり該殺し処理具1が差し込まれていることを知ることができる。
【0012】
なお、尾部5は完全に切り離すことなく、図1()に示すように、脊柱6に達する切欠き部7を設け、その切欠き部7の部分に端部1aを露出させるようにしてもよい。
【0013】
図2に示した他の実施形態は、頭部8を頭蓋骨3を含む部分又はこれより若干後部において切断除去する。尾部5を切断除去することは前記と同様である。しかる後に、頭部8側の切断面に現れた脊柱6内に殺し処理具1を差し込み、尾部5側の切断面まで刺し通す。この場合も、殺し処理具1の両端部1a,1bをそれぞれ上記の両端部から外部に露出させる。尾部5を切断除去することなく、前記の図1(d)に示すように切欠き部7を設けて、端部1をその切欠き部7の部分から外部に露出させるようにしてもよい。
【0014】
この場合は頭部8の切断により脳が除去又は破壊されているので、上記の殺し具1は脊柱6内部の脊髄等の神経組織を破壊し、迅速に完全死に至らしめる。
【0015】
【発明の効果】
以上のように、この発明によれば、魚体の脊柱に差し込まれた1本の線状の殺し処理具の両端部を魚体の頭部側と尾部側からそれぞれ外部に露出せしめ、そのまま市場に出荷するようにしたので、脊柱の全長にわたり殺し処理具が挿通され適正に殺し処理がされていることを外部から容易に確認することができる。

[0001]
B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ION
The present invention relates to a large fish such as tuna that has been killed.
[0002]
[Prior art]
When catching large fish such as tuna, it is necessary to kill and process them quickly and reliably in order to keep the fish fresh. As a treatment method suitable for such killing treatment, a linear killing tool is inserted from the white crest portion of the head of the fish body or the cut surface of the head, and this is reached inside the spine to destroy the central nervous tissue. Methods are conventionally known. In addition, the above-mentioned killing processing tool is killed and left in the processed fish body, and the processing tool is confirmed in the market to confirm that the fish body has been processed by the above method. It is also known to notify (see Japanese Utility Model Publication No. 2-3757, Japanese Utility Model Publication No. 4-36624, Japanese Utility Model Publication No. 4-55516).
[0003]
[Problems to be solved by the invention]
Large fish such as tuna that have been killed have been properly treated by inserting the treatment tool close to the tail, but conventionally, one end of the treatment tool is exposed from the head of the fish body. Because it was only, it was difficult to confirm in the market whether the other end had reached the tail.
[0004]
Accordingly, an object of the present invention is to make it possible to easily confirm in the market that the above-mentioned processing tool is securely inserted to the vicinity of the tail and is properly processed.
[0005]
[Means for Solving the Problems]
Since resolve the above problems, the present invention, plug linear killed processing tool inside the spinal column from the head of the fish, in killing the treated large fish comprising brought leaving the processing tool inside the spinal column, said killing One end of the treatment tool is exposed to the outside from the tail of the fish body, and the other end of the treatment tool connected to the one end is exposed to the outside from the head of the fish body.
[0006]
One end of the killing tool can be exposed to the outside from the cut surface of the tail of the fish body, and one end can be exposed to the outside from a notch that reaches the spinal column of the tail of the fish body.
[0007]
Further, the other end of the killing tool can be exposed to the outside from the white crest portion of the fish head, and the other end can be exposed to the outside from the cut surface of the fish head.
[0008]
DETAILED DESCRIPTION OF THE INVENTION
Embodiments of the present invention will be described below with reference to the drawings. The killing tool 1 used in the first embodiment shown in FIG. 1 is obtained by cutting a linear synthetic resin (nylon, polypropylene, etc.) into a predetermined length corresponding to the fish body 2 of a large fish. Its thickness is about 3 to 5 mm. A hollow tube may be used, but in that case, plugs are fitted to both ends.
[0009]
There is a relatively soft white crest in the middle part of both eyes of a large fish body 2 such as a tuna. The above-mentioned white crest portion of the captured large fish body 2 is stabbed or scraped with a blade to make a hole 4 in a part of the skull 3, and the tail portion 5 is cut off. The cut end of the spine 6 appears on the cut surface after the tail portion 5 is cut off.
[0010]
Next, one end of the killing treatment tool 1 is inserted into the hole 4 and pushed forward to be exposed from the inside of the skull 3 through the spinal column 6 to the outside from the cut end on the tail 5 side. By inserting the killing tool 1, the central nervous tissue such as the brain and spinal cord of the fish body 2 is destroyed, and the fish body 2 can be brought to complete death quickly.
[0011]
After completing the killing process, one end 1a of the killing tool 1 is exposed to the outside from the cut surface of the tail part 5 for a required length, and the other end 1b continuous to this end 1a is exposed to the head 8 The required length is exposed to the outside from the side hole 4 and shipped to the market with both ends 1a and 1b exposed. In the market, by confirming both end portions 1a and 1b of the killing treatment tool 1, it can be known that the killing treatment tool 1 is inserted from the head 8 over the entire length of the spine 6.
[0012]
The tail 5 is not completely separated, and a notch 7 reaching the spinal column 6 is provided as shown in FIG. 1 ( d ), and the end 1 a is exposed at the notch 7. Good.
[0013]
In the other embodiment shown in FIG. 2, the head 8 is cut off at the part including the skull 3 or slightly behind it. Cutting and removing the tail 5 is the same as described above. After that, the slaughtering tool 1 is inserted into the spine 6 appearing on the cut surface on the head 8 side, and pierced to the cut surface on the tail 5 side. Also in this case, both ends 1a and 1b of the killing treatment tool 1 are exposed to the outside from the both ends. Without cutting and removing the tail portion 5, the notch portion 7 may be provided as shown in FIG. 1D, and the end portion 1 a may be exposed to the outside from the portion of the notch portion 7. .
[0014]
In this case, since the brain is removed or destroyed by cutting the head 8, the killing device 1 destroys the nerve tissue such as the spinal cord inside the spinal column 6, and promptly causes complete death.
[0015]
【The invention's effect】
As described above, according to the present invention, both ends of one linear killing tool inserted into the fish spine are exposed to the outside from the head side and tail side of the fish body and shipped to the market as they are. Therefore, it can be easily confirmed from the outside that the killing tool is inserted through the entire length of the spinal column and the killing process is properly performed.
